I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

 Java Discussion :

Gérer une image et des points au dessus


Sujet :

Java

  1. #1
    Membre éclairé Avatar de Caxton
    Homme Profil pro
    Sans
    Inscrit en
    Janvier 2005
    Messages
    586
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 47
    Localisation : France, Corrèze (Limousin)

    Informations professionnelles :
    Activité : Sans

    Informations forums :
    Inscription : Janvier 2005
    Messages : 586
    Par défaut Gérer une image et des points au dessus
    Bonsoir tout le monde,
    Je débute en java et je voudrais faire une application en swing qui puisse afficher une image en fond et des points dessus.

    Au niveau du comportement, si je passe la souris dur l'image et que je fait un click gauche dessus, un menu apparait ou je peux créer un point aux coordonnées sélectionné. A ce moment la j'ouvre une fenêtre modale qui permet de créer physiquement le point et qui sera stocker dans un fichier. J'ai d'ailleurs déjà regardé comment cela se passe pour les fichier et j'arrive à les gérer parfaitement.
    Si je passe la souris sur un point mais que je le clique sur rien, un menu apparait et je voie donc apparaitre les informations contenu dans le fichier.
    Soi je clique gauche sur un point et un menu apparait me permettant soit de modifier le point, soit de le supprimer.

    J'aurais bien voulue savoir si une fenêtre swing eput supporté un tel projet, et si c'est le cas par quel bout je doit m'y prendre pour le réalisé.

    J'espère que ma demande n'est pas trop difficile à comprendre.
    Cordialement.

  2. #2
    Membre Expert
    Avatar de gifffftane
    Profil pro
    Inscrit en
    Février 2007
    Messages
    2 354
    Détails du profil
    Informations personnelles :
    Localisation : France, Loire (Rhône Alpes)

    Informations forums :
    Inscription : Février 2007
    Messages : 2 354
    Par défaut
    Oui, une application swing peut permettre de le réaliser.

    Par quel bout le prendre ? Par le petit

    Lire les docs, bien sûr, etc, j'imagine que tu connais. Tu affiches une fenêtre (EN TE DOCUMENTANT SUR LES IMPERATIFS DE L'///// EDT \\\\\\\ ) puis tu y mets une image dedans, etc. Facile.

  3. #3
    Membre éclairé Avatar de Caxton
    Homme Profil pro
    Sans
    Inscrit en
    Janvier 2005
    Messages
    586
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 47
    Localisation : France, Corrèze (Limousin)

    Informations professionnelles :
    Activité : Sans

    Informations forums :
    Inscription : Janvier 2005
    Messages : 586
    Par défaut
    Bonsoir,
    Tout d'abord je voudrais remercie de cette première réponse.

    Pour ce qui est de:
    Citation Envoyé par gifffftane Voir le message
    Par quel bout le prendre ? Par le petit
    ok! Ceci dit tout ce qui est petit finira grand

    Citation Envoyé par gifffftane Voir le message
    Lire les docs, bien sûr, etc, j'imagine que tu connais. Tu affiches une fenêtre (EN TE DOCUMENTANT SUR LES IMPERATIFS DE L'///// EDT \\\\\\\ ) puis tu y mets une image dedans, etc. Facile.
    Encore d'accord mais... au risque de passer pour un noob, c'est quoi l' EDT ?

    Si c'est en rapport avec l'edi, j'utilise netbeans6.7. C'est vrai que j'ai pour habitude de sous-traiter le code swing à mon edi. Je pensait surtout avec ma question à faire une sorte de dérivé de composant implémentée par ma classe, ou mieux, que ma classe puisse servir de composant.

    De toute façon ça sera l'un ou l'autre, pas les deux.
    Un autre détail, j'aimerais autant que faire ce peu que mon code soit portable dans d'autres applications de mon cru.

    Cordialement.

  4. #4
    Membre Expert
    Avatar de gifffftane
    Profil pro
    Inscrit en
    Février 2007
    Messages
    2 354
    Détails du profil
    Informations personnelles :
    Localisation : France, Loire (Rhône Alpes)

    Informations forums :
    Inscription : Février 2007
    Messages : 2 354

  5. #5
    Membre éclairé Avatar de Caxton
    Homme Profil pro
    Sans
    Inscrit en
    Janvier 2005
    Messages
    586
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 47
    Localisation : France, Corrèze (Limousin)

    Informations professionnelles :
    Activité : Sans

    Informations forums :
    Inscription : Janvier 2005
    Messages : 586
    Par défaut
    Et zut!
    La & j'aurais du y pensé plus tôt !
    Je look ça et je te dis ce que j'en retient

  6. #6
    Membre éclairé Avatar de Caxton
    Homme Profil pro
    Sans
    Inscrit en
    Janvier 2005
    Messages
    586
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 47
    Localisation : France, Corrèze (Limousin)

    Informations professionnelles :
    Activité : Sans

    Informations forums :
    Inscription : Janvier 2005
    Messages : 586
    Par défaut
    Alors voila. L'EDT est en fait un nom donné à une suite "logique" d'action automatique dans AWT et SWING
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
     
    -Dessin de la fenêtre
    -Ecoute des entrées
    -Repaint() //C'est ici que c'est intéressant pour mon cas
                  //Gère aussi le cas ou un composant est en train de se repaindre, si on compte repaindre dessus
    -Sauter au début
    On m'arrêtera/corrigera si je me trompe

    Ceci dit, est ce que NetBeans6.7 à prévus le cas d'un repaint() ?
    Si oui comment ?
    Si non, faut-il passer par un codage entièrement à la main (Ce qui ne sera, dans mon cas, pas très pratique).

    En tout cas merci pour le tuyau, ca ma déjà un peu guidé.
    Cordialement
    Cordialement

Discussions similaires

  1. Réponses: 1
    Dernier message: 17/04/2013, 10h50
  2. Comment obtenir une image resultante des 3 bandes
    Par zaiim dans le forum Images
    Réponses: 4
    Dernier message: 17/04/2007, 19h49
  3. rollover dans une image avec des zones cliquables
    Par brasco06 dans le forum Balisage (X)HTML et validation W3C
    Réponses: 2
    Dernier message: 23/02/2006, 11h15
  4. Réponses: 3
    Dernier message: 31/10/2005, 16h47
  5. réafficher une image à partir des données recupérées
    Par vbcasimir dans le forum Langage
    Réponses: 3
    Dernier message: 04/10/2005, 10h50

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o